HB 1908: An Act amending Title 23 (Domestic Relations) of the Pennsylvania Consolidated Statutes, in protection from abuse, further providing for arrest for violation of order and for contempt for violation of order or agreement.

HB 1908 amends Pennsylvania's domestic relations law to strengthen enforcement of protection orders in abuse cases. The bill requires law enforcement to make an arrest when someone violates a protection order, rather than allowing discretion. It also specifies that violating a protection order or a related agreement (like a custody agreement) can be treated as contempt of court. This directly affects victims of domestic abuse, law enforcement officers, and individuals subject to protection orders by changing how violations are handled under the law.
